Pansy Bo specimen from Dharma Type

A 19th-century-inspired handwritten script with an inky texture that mimics the look of authentic pen calligraphy.

About

Modelled on 19th-century script styles, Pansy Bo replicates the uneven ink deposit and flowing strokes of period handwriting. The result carries an antique character well-suited to vintage branding, packaging and decorative design work. Its nostalgic quality sits naturally alongside historical imagery and heritage-oriented aesthetics.
